WCR: In a nutshell... Not good. No test taken, and no insulin given this evening at least. She didn't come out of her cubby hole for anything, and I didn't force her. She didn't acknowledge me very much when we came home this afternoon. When I said "num nums", her eyes perked up, but her head remained down. I fed the others their meal, and then gave her the regular amount with the regular amount of water. I had to move her head out of the hole in order to feed her. She ate it.. about 9/10's, and it took her about 25 minutes. I gave her the Tramadol dose at PMPS +.5. I'm not sure if she's having an off day, or not. I decided to not test or give her any insulin this evening. Her neuropathy is slowly, but surely getting worse. When she walks, she walks slowly as if she's contemplating her steps, and where she puts her feet. Her incontinence is becoming a bit more frequent now. This morning, she peed on the plastic mats under the chairs in the office. I have puppy pads down, but nothing was done on them.
If she's out, I'll test her. With regards to her appetite, I'll be withholding the insulin as I don't want to give her any insulin if she's not eating. I'll give you an update tomorrow.
